Practical Guidance for Pastors Each compact topical ministerial handbook in the new Pastoral Pocket Guides series helps equip and empower pastors and church leaders to carry out the day-to-day work of Christian ministry with excellence and confidence.
In the Faith and Baptism guide you'll find:
Proven ways to share the good news personally and also extend an invitation from the pulpit
Scriptures to know and sample prayers
Practical baptism tips
Baptism service and celebration ideas and more!
About the Author John Fanella has been both a pastor and writer for the past 30 years. He and his family live in a parsonage in the bucolic countryside of western Pennsylvania. Beyond his pastoral heart and editorial talents, two things to know about John: He's a prankster and he's afraid of spiders.
